Synopsis
Beatrice Alright is the queen of silver linings. She can find a spark of hope in any situation. Even when her partner delivers earth-shattering news that leaves Bea and their four-year-old, Ellie, without a home, she refuses to panic., Beatrice Alright is the queen of silver linings. She can find a spark of hope in any situation. Even when her partner delivers earth-shattering news that leaves Bea and their four-year-old, Ellie, without a home, she refuses to panic. Because Bea believes that what she does have is more important - her job at St Helen's Hospital, which offers a warm, dry shelter for her and Ellie to stay while she figures things out. By day Bea cleans the wards, by night she tucks her daughter into bed between mops and buckets. And tries so hard to hold on to hope. When Bea sees an old man sitting on a cold and lonely bench outside the hospital, she really doesn't have time to stop. She should be clearing up her own mess, not worrying about this cantankerous stranger. But Bea can't help herself... As she slowly starts to draw out Malcolm's heartbreaking story, could this simple act of kindness begin to heal a decades-old pain? And might finding peace for Malcolm help Bea in ways she didn't even know she needed? A moving, emotional and uplifting story about second chances and chosen families guaranteed to break your heart and patch it back up again.
